Description

Join us this week as we dive into the world of Plywood with our team members Jeff, Kayla, and Emily. In this episode, we explore the exciting new Layers program, uncover Plywood's community connections, and discover invaluable advice for those feeling stuck and unsure of their next steps. Jeff, Kayla, and Emily share their insights on harnessing the power of community support, empowering individuals to drive impactful change, and forging a stronger sense of purpose. Tune in and be inspired!__Welcome to the Plywood Podcast: Real talk for social entrepreneurs and nonprofit leaders.Plywood is a nonprofit in Atlanta leading a community of startups doing good. Over the past 12 years, we have worked with over 1000 startup founders and nonprofit leaders wrestling with the tensions of starting, growing, and sustaining.Think of The Plywood Podcast as a kitchen table conversation debating the pros and woes of running a business and sustaining a nonprofit.
